Basilica Of The National Shrine Of The Immaculate Conception

Basilica of the national shrine of the Immaculate conception is the biggest Roman Catholic church in US and also one of the largest churches in the world. The interiors of this basilica are Greek and have large mosaics throughout the building. About 70 chapels are held inside, worshipping Mary and shimmering the roots of Catholic orders. The church offers 6 masses and 5 hours of confession every day. About a million people visit this basilica every year. Basilica of the National Shrine of the Immaculate Conception is recognized as the largest Roman Catholic Church in the United States and North America. It also stands as one of the ten largest churches in the world. This venue is all set to welcome pilgrims and tourists coming to see it magnificence.

This church enjoys a convenient location in Washington, D.C., and is world famous for its unique architecture, striking sacred art (comprising the largest collection of contemporary ecclesiastical art in the world). This venue is a true representative of Catholic and American history and heritage.

Nearly one million people visit this world famous church as it remains all the days to welcome individuals, families, groups, tours, buses, and pilgrimages. This venue accommodates a gift shop, book store, and cafeteria to offer a complete touring experience. Further, it offers free parking and guided tours to the visitors.

The place remains open for individual pilgrims as well as scores of diocesan, ethnic and group pilgrimages throughout the year. Pilgrims are welcomes to participate in the Sacrament of Penance and in the celebration of Mass and special Marian devotions. Pilgrimages paid here have become an act of religious devotion that includes penitential themes, intercession and gratitude. The shrines here are dedicated to the Blessed Mother and comprise as the major pilgrimage sites.

The Basilica of the National Shrine of the Immaculate Conception serves the United States Conference of Catholic Bishops. The basilica also has 70 chapels honored by American renditions of classical catholic scenes and is dedicated to Mary, catholic immigrants to the country and religious orders which was a key factor in building the basilica.

The structure of the Basilica is inspired by the Greek Style and has numerous dome like structures adorning its exterior. Another striking feature of the Basilica of the National Shrine of the Immaculate Conception is the mosaic which covers the northern apse. Also in 2009, a competition was held the Catholic University of the United States to determine who will create the mosaic covering the Trinity Dome. The rector of the Basilica of the National Shrine of the Immaculate Conception is The Reverend Monsignor Walter R. Rossi, Rector.

In 2008, on his visits, Pope Benedict XVI, bestowed the Golden Rose upon the Basilica of the National Shrine of the Immaculate Conception and this basilica is one of the foremost religious installations in the United States and is a must see for any visitor to the capital city of Washington DC.
